About Mark Thomas Cain at a glance
Mark Thomas Cain is a Member based in Greensboro, North Carolina, practicing at Schell Bray PLLC. They have 39+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1987. Their practice focuses on business. Admitted to practice in Tennessee (1987) and North Carolina (1988). Educated at The University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ill (J.D., 1987) and The University of Michigan (B.A., 1983). Recognitions include BV Distinguished. Why local counsel matters in North Carolina
Practicing law in North Carolina. Legal matters in North Carolina are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Greensboro are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ate North Carolina state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in North Carolina br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in North Carolina cour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
